President Ayub incredibly aptly described the vital scenario when he claimed that “never ever prior to have India and Pakistan been nearer to war than throughout the latest weeks when the armies of both of those nations have stood in menacing confrontation together the whole Indo-Pakistan border”.
As President Ayub advised the Soviet Press within an job interview, the Tashkent Declaration had not long gone in terms of it must have completed to resolve the Kashmir dispute, which was The essential click here dilemma that developed stresses and strains between India and Pakistan. He rightly built it obvious on the Soviet Press that authentic and lasting friendship involving India and Pakistan could arrive only after a just Alternative on the Kashmir dispute Which his hope was that the Declaration would add to that stop. This really is in truth the crux from the matter. Even so, the President has rightly known as this a fantastic beginning as well as Declaration does enable The 2 international locations to produce a start about the highway resulting in the normalisation of bilateral relations, but In case the goal of authentic friendship would be to be realized it's important, once the needs of your declaration happen to be fulfilled, to focus on gettinq the explosive Kashmir issue from just how.
